This property could be just for you.
Raine and Horne Berry has just listed 33 Prince Alfred Street, a lovely cottage which effortlessly blends "timeless appeal of its 1890s heritage with the modern conveniences expected by today's families."
"This gorgeous, newly renovated 130-year-old cottage is ready for its next custodians," said Jacqui Crapp, of Raine and Horne Berry.
"The cottage is nestled within an idyllic private garden setting."

Its warm and welcoming interiors have been stylishly and sympathetically renovated and include four peaceful bedrooms, a tranquil lounge with pretty garden outlooks, an elegant dining room, open plan kitchen / living room and additional separate weatherboard self-contained one bedroom cottage completed in the same style as the home.
A stunning, country style kitchen is the hub of the home, featuring a spectacular oversized island bench.
"Quality appliances - two ovens and induction cooktop, beautiful lighting, and a butler's pantry complete the space to the highest of standards," Ms Crapp said.
The rear of the home lends itself to family living or entertaining, with a spacious open plan living/dining featuring expansive bi-fold doors which open to the north facing covered entertaining area, providing seamless movement between the indoor and outdoor living spaces.
The master bedroom enjoys a quiet position and features a glamorous walk-in robe along with a lavishly appointed ensuite featuring stunning tapware, double sinks, marble benchtops and heated floor.
"Luxe touches such as oak flooring, stone bench-tops throughout, plantation shutters, working fireplaces and exquisite period detailing are among the highlights," she said.
The property has ducted heating and cooling, reverse cycle to living area, a large laundry with extensive storage, a spacious landscaped backyard, a carport with extra off-street parking are all offered.
The luxurious self-contained garden cottage is perfect for entertaining or a peaceful space, with vaulted ceilings, bedroom/living space, kitchenette, quality bathroom and timber deck.
"All of this, in the heart of the village - walking distance to all historic Berry has to offer including schools, shops, cafes, restaurants, parks, train station - there is no better location," she said.
